当前位置:AIGC资讯 > 数据采集 > 正文

深入解析“we7 cms爬虫”技术与应用

在当今信息爆炸的时代,内容管理系统(CMS)已经成为了网站建设不可或缺的一部分。其中,we7 cms作为一款备受欢迎的CMS系统,凭借其强大的功能和灵活的扩展性,赢得了众多站长的青睐。而随着互联网数据的不断增长,爬虫技术也逐渐崭露头角,成为数据挖掘和信息获取的重要手段。本文将深入解析we7 cms爬虫的技术原理、应用场景以及面临的挑战,为读者全面展现这一技术的魅力与价值。
一、we7 cms爬虫技术概述
we7 cms爬虫,顾名思义,是基于we7 cms系统构建的爬虫程序。它通过网络爬虫技术,自动化地抓取、解析并提取we7 cms网站中的有用信息,进而实现对网站数据的快速获取与分析。爬虫技术主要包含网页抓取、数据解析和数据存储三个核心环节。
1. 网页抓取:爬虫程序通过模拟浏览器行为,向we7 cms网站发出请求,并接收返回的网页数据。这一过程中,爬虫需要遵循网站的robots.txt协议,确保合法合规地进行数据抓取。
2. 数据解析:获取到网页数据后,爬虫需要对其进行解析,提取出有用的信息。针对we7 cms的特点,爬虫可以利用其固有的页面结构和数据标签,通过正则表达式、XPath或BeautifulSoup等工具进行高效解析。
3. 数据存储:解析得到的数据最终需要被存储起来,以便后续的分析和利用。we7 cms爬虫可以将数据保存至本地文件、数据库或云存储等服务中,根据实际需求选择合适的数据存储方案。
二、we7 cms爬虫的应用场景
we7 cms爬虫技术的广泛应用,为各行各业带来了巨大的便利与价值。以下是几个典型的应用场景:
1. 内容聚合与平台搭建:在自媒体时代,内容聚合平台成为了信息传播的重要枢纽。通过we7 cms爬虫,可以抓取多个we7 cms网站的内容,实现一站式的内容聚合与呈现,为用户提供更加丰富多样的阅读体验。
2. 数据分析与挖掘:对于企业而言,了解市场动态、把握用户需求至关重要。we7 cms爬虫可以帮助企业抓取行业网站中的数据,进行深入的数据分析与挖掘,为企业的战略决策提供有力支持。
3. 舆情监测与危机应对:在互联网时代,舆情监测对于政府和企业而言具有重要意义。we7 cms爬虫能够实时监控社交媒体、论坛等we7 cms平台上的舆论动态,及时发现并应对潜在的危机事件。
4. 竞品分析与市场调研:在激烈的市场竞争中,对竞品的分析和市场的调研显得尤为重要。we7 cms爬虫可以帮助企业抓取竞品网站的信息,进行全面的对比分析,为企业的市场竞争提供有力武器。
三、we7 cms爬虫面临的挑战与应对策略
然而,随着技术的不断发展,we7 cms爬虫也面临着一系列挑战。以下是几个主要的挑战及相应的应对策略:
1. 反爬虫机制:为了保护网站的数据安全,越来越多的we7 cms网站开始采用反爬虫技术。针对这一问题,爬虫程序需要不断升级和优化,以适应不断变化的反爬虫策略。例如,可以通过设置合理的请求头、使用代理IP等方式来降低被识别为爬虫的风险。
2. 数据解析难度:随着we7 cms系统的不断升级和改版,网页结构可能发生变化,导致之前的数据解析规则失效。因此,爬虫程序需要具备一定的自适应能力,能够根据实际情况调整解析策略。此外,还可以借助机器学习和自然语言处理技术来辅助数据解析,提高解析的准确率和效率。
3. 法律风险与合规性:在进行we7 cms爬虫开发时,必须严格遵守相关法律法规,确保数据的合法获取和使用。同时,爬虫程序还需要遵循网站的robots.txt协议,尊重网站的爬虫策略,避免侵犯他人的权益。
4. 性能与效率问题:面对海量的web数据和复杂的网络环境,we7 cms爬虫的性能和效率至关重要。为了提高性能,可以采用分布式爬虫架构,将任务分配给多个节点并行处理。同时,还可以通过优化代码、压缩数据等方式来减少不必要的资源消耗,提升爬虫的整体运行效率。
四、结论
综上所述,we7 cms爬虫技术以其强大的数据获取能力和灵活的应用场景,为各行各业带来了巨大的便利与价值。然而,在实际应用过程中,我们也需要正视其所面临的挑战和问题,并采取有效的应对策略以确保其合法、高效、稳定地运行。随着技术的不断进步和创新应用的不断涌现,相信we7 cms爬虫将会在未来发挥更加重要的作用。

更新时间 2024-05-23